titleOfInvention | Dialkyl or alkylenephosphonylaethylene glycols and processes for their preparation |
abstract | These have formula (where R1 and R2 are C1-C6 alkyl groups or R1 and R2 are a C2 or C3 alkylene hydrocarbon chain). They may be prepared by reacting a dialkyl or alkylene phosphonyl dioxolane in aqueous solution with a base at ph approx. 9.5 and a temperature between 0-30 degrees C, preferably between 20-25 degrees C. The compounds are non-inflammable and may be used to impregnate wood, paper and textiles. They are also useful starting materials for the preparation of esters and polyesters, urethanes and polyurethanes. |
